The sum of 5 consecutive even numbers is 310. What is the third number in this sequence?

Answers

Answer 1
Answer: A simple way to solve for consecutive numbers is to divide the sum number by the number of numbers needed. So 310 ÷ 5, which equals 62. That is the middle consecutive number.

To find the other 4 numbers, since they are all even, sinply add 2 to the middle number to find one, add 2 to that to find another, subtract 2 from the middle number to fine the third, and subtract 2 from that to find the final one.

62 + 2 = 64
64 + 2 = 66
62 - 2 = 60
60 - 2 = 58

so your numbers are 58, 60, 62, 52, and 66. Together they add up to 310.

If you can only use 3 of these numbers once to find a sum of 30 without subtracting or adding additional numbers, what three numbers would you use out of 1, 3, 5, 7, 9, 11, 13, and 15? ()+()+()=30

Answers

Answer:

The correct answer is

It is impossible to add odd numbers (1, 3, 5, 7, 9, 11, 13, and 15) and odd number of times (3) to get an even number (30)

Step-by-step explanation:

1, 3, 5, 7, 9, 11, 13, and 15 are all odd numbers and 30 is an even number

When odd numbers are added even times the answer is always even for example 3 + 5 = 8,  and when odd numbers are added odd times the answer is always odd for example 1 + 5 + 7 = 13

It is not possible to add three odd numbers to get an even number
